Character Development Encourages Guest Participation
Encouraging guests to adopt characters or personas aligned with the chosen theme creates deeper engagement and more memorable experiences than passive observation alone. This approach transforms dinner parties from entertainment consumption into collaborative creative experiences where guests become co-creators of the evening’s narrative. Character assignments can range from specific historical figures to general archetypes that allow for personal interpretation while maintaining thematic consistency.
The development of character guidelines and background information helps guests prepare for their roles while avoiding overwhelming those who may feel uncomfortable with extensive performance requirements. Providing simple costume suggestions, character motivation cards, or brief historical context enables participants to engage at their comfort level while contributing to the overall themed atmosphere. This collaborative approach creates shared experiences that strengthen social bonds and generate conversations that extend well beyond the dinner party itself.
Menu Design As Cultural Time Travel
Themed menus offer opportunities to transport guests through time and geography via carefully researched and authentically prepared dishes that reflect specific periods, regions, or cultural traditions. The most effective themed menus go beyond simply serving food that matches the theme to include preparation methods, presentation styles, and dining customs that enhance the overall immersive experience. This attention to culinary authenticity requires research into historical cooking techniques, ingredient availability, and traditional serving methods.
The integration of educational elements into menu presentations helps guests understand the cultural significance of dishes while enhancing their appreciation for the themed experience. Brief explanations of dish origins, preparation methods, or cultural context can be incorporated into menu cards or delivered through brief presentations that inform without interrupting the flow of conversation. This educational component transforms themed dining from entertainment into cultural exploration that satisfies intellectual curiosity alongside physical hunger.
Interactive Elements Create Shared Memories
Incorporating interactive activities that align with the chosen theme creates opportunities for guests to engage with each other in ways that transcend typical dinner party conversation. These activities might include period-appropriate games, collaborative creative projects, or problem-solving challenges that require teamwork and communication. The key lies in selecting activities that enhance rather than compete with the dining experience, creating natural conversation starters and shared experiences.
The timing and integration of interactive elements requires careful consideration of meal pacing and guest energy levels throughout the evening. Activities that work well during cocktail hours may not be appropriate during formal dining courses, while post-dinner activities should account for guests’ comfort levels and energy after substantial meals. This strategic placement of interactive elements helps maintain engagement while respecting the natural rhythm of social dining experiences.

Timing Orchestration Creates Emotional Peaks
The pacing of themed dinner parties requires understanding how to build emotional engagement through carefully timed revelations, surprises, and activity transitions that maintain guest interest without creating exhaustion. This orchestration involves planning multiple emotional peaks throughout the evening, each building upon previous experiences to create a crescendo of engagement that leaves guests feeling satisfied and energized rather than overwhelmed or underwhelmed.
The natural rhythm of social dining provides a framework for planning these emotional peaks, with aperitifs creating initial excitement, appetizers building anticipation, main courses providing satisfying climax, and desserts offering gentle resolution. Interactive elements, surprise reveals, and special presentations can be strategically placed within this framework to maximize impact while maintaining the flow of conversation and connection that defines successful dinner parties.
